What Is Compost, Really?
Compost is organic material that has broken down into a rich, dark soil amendment full of nutrients that plants love. Things like kitchen scraps, leaves, grass clippings, and other natural materials slowly decompose and turn into what gardeners often call black gold.
And that nickname isn’t an exaggeration. Finished compost enhances soil structure, nourishes plants, and fosters long-term soil health. It truly enriches the soil, and as some would say, “is worth its weight in gold.”
For a home gardener, composting is about closing the loop, turning what would normally be waste into nourishment for the next season.
What is Compost Made Of?
Whichever way you choose to compost (we’ll talk about methods later), all compost needs the same basic ingredients:
- Carbon
- Nitrogen
- Oxygen
- Water
- Microorganisms
Bacteria, fungi, insects, and worms do the real work here. Our job is to give them the right environment so they can naturally build the humus our gardens need.

Greens and Browns: The Building Blocks
When people talk about composting, they often mention greens and browns. This isn’t about color, but about what each material contributes.
Greens are materials high in nitrogen. They help heat up the compost and feed microorganisms as they decompose. Greens are usually fresh or moist.
Common greens include:
- Fruit and vegetable scraps
- Fresh grass clippings (untreated)
- Coffee grounds and tea bags
- Healthy plant trimmings
- Manure from herbivore animals like rabbits, cows, sheep, or chickens
Browns are materials high in carbon. They provide structure, absorb moisture, and keep the compost from becoming compact or smelly. Browns are usually dry.
Common browns include:
- Dry leaves
- Pine needles
- Straw or hay
- Small branches or wood chips
- Shredded paper, cardboard, paper plates, and coffee filters (no tape or wax)
If there’s one thing to remember, it’s this: compost doesn’t need to be exact to work. A mix of greens and browns added over time will usually balance itself out.
Air, Water, and Heat
Compost needs air and moisture to break down properly. Oxygen allows microorganisms to do their work, which is why turning the compost occasionally can help. You don’t need to fuss over it, just mix things up now and then to keep the air moving through it.
Moisture is important, too. Compost should feel like a wrung-out sponge: damp, but not dripping wet. Too dry and the process slows down; too wet and it starts to smell.
Heat is a natural result of decomposition. As microorganisms break down organic matter, they create warmth, and sometimes it can feel surprisingly hot. This warmth helps materials break down faster.
You don’t need to heat your compost on purpose. Keeping a good mix of greens and browns, maintaining light moisture, and turning the compost occasionally are enough. When microorganisms are comfortable, the heat follows.
This is called aerobic composting, which simply means the pile has air. When compost has oxygen, it breaks down cleanly and smells earthy. Without enough air, compost becomes anaerobic, slowing the process and often creating unpleasant odors. A little airflow and the right moisture keep everything moving the way nature intended.
Microorganisms: The Real Workforce
Microorganisms are what turn scraps and yard waste into finished compost. Bacteria and fungi break down materials at a microscopic level, while insects and worms help by shredding and mixing everything together.
You don’t need to add anything special to invite them in – they’re already present in your soil, kitchen scraps, and yard debris. When you provide food, moisture, and air, they show up and get to work.
Healthy compost is really just a healthy ecosystem.

Using Compost to Improve Garden Soil
Regardless of where you garden or the type of garden you have, compost helps solve some of the most common soil problems. It doesn’t replace your soil, but works with it, gradually improving it over time.
Healthy soil isn’t about having the perfect dirt. It’s about structure, moisture, and life in the soil. Compost supports all of these.
Let’s look at how compost can improve different types of soil.
Heavy or Compacted Soils
If your soil is heavy, hard, or full of clay, compost can loosen it up. When I was growing up, my family gardened in heavy clay. I saw how my parents used tilling for aeration and mixed in composted animal manure from a family member’s farm. It was just a little bit added every year, and it fluffed up that clay and provided a healthy home for my mom’s garden plants.
I’ve seen firsthand how compost can improve heavy soil, allowing air and water to move more freely through the soil. Research backs this up as well. The U.S. Environmental Protection Agency notes that adding compost increases soil organic matter, improves soil structure, and helps reduce heavy soils.
Sandy or Fast-Draining Soils
Sandy soil drains quickly, which can leave plants struggling to get enough water and nutrients. Compost helps by increasing the soil’s ability to hold moisture while still draining well.
In sandy soils, compost acts like a sponge. It holds onto water and nutrients long enough for plant roots to use them instead of letting everything wash away. Over time, repeated additions of compost help build a richer, more stable growing environment.
How to Add Compost to the Garden
There’s no single right way to use compost. The best method is the one that fits your garden and your energy level.
You can mix compost into the top few inches of soil before planting, or simply spread it on the surface as a mulch or top-dressing. Nature will take it from there. Worms, insects, and rainfall help move nutrients down into the soil without much effort from you.
Compost works best when it’s added regularly, even in small amounts. Think of it as feeding your soil, not fixing it.
A Note for Florida Gardeners
Much of Florida has sandy soil that struggles to hold nutrients, especially during heavy rains. In these conditions, compost isn’t a one-time amendment—it’s part of the gardening rhythm.
When I first started gardening in Florida, keeping my soil healthy was one of my biggest challenges. I could add compost and amendments, plant carefully, and still watch nutrients disappear after a few good downpours. Over time, I learned—through trial and error, advice from other Florida gardeners, and guidance from UF | IFAS Extension—that building soil here isn’t about quick fixes.
What finally made the difference was consistency. Small, regular additions of compost helped rebuild organic matter in my soil, giving it a better chance to hold moisture and nutrients instead of letting them wash away. Each season, the soil improved a little more. Plants grew stronger. Water and nutrients stayed where they were needed. Eventually, the garden became easier to manage.
Florida gardening asks for patience, but it rewards steady effort. Compost won’t change sandy soil overnight, but over time, it turns challenging ground into something far more forgiving.

Common Composting Methods
You don’t need a complicated setup to compost successfully. Gardeners have been improving their soil for generations using simple methods like these:
- Backyard compost pile. A designated spot where kitchen scraps and yard waste are layered and allowed to break down over time.
- Compost bin. Enclosed system that keeps materials contained and works well in smaller or more visible spaces.
- Trench or in-ground composting. Scraps are buried directly in the garden, feeding the soil where plants will grow.
- Small-scale composting. Options like worm bins or compact systems for those with limited outdoor space.
Each method works. The difference comes down to what fits your lifestyle and garden best.
